I have squirrelly steering.

I have found that my offside front wheel has play in it. On the horizontal. None perceptible vertical.

At first I thought it was the torque of the stubb. So I checked it at 68lbft as per manual.

But I still have play. The disk and wheel, in fact the whole hub seems to have play.

Could it be a knackered bearing ?

Other side is fine !!

Check for wear in the track rod end or steering rack. Could also be the wheel bearing, but I find that is best felt in the vertical plane.

Hope it is in the tie rod end (called track rod above). It can also be in the rack. And if so, much more difficult to cope with. You can replace rod ends quickly and inexpensively, if in North America I recommend British Parts Northwest (early Spitfire).
